Prescription drugs debate continues on Capitol Hill
The battle over reducing Medicare's cost for prescription drugs flared up on Capitol Hill on Thursday as lawmakers continued to debate deficit-reduction plans that could curb the program's growth. While Republicans have emphasized the successes of Medicare Part D in lowering drug costs, Democrats say drug prices are still higher ...
